Zombry is a Zombie -type Pokemon.
It evolves into Charund if its attack is greater than its defense, starting at level 24. It evolves into Spiombie if its attack is lower than its defense, starting at level 24. It evolves into Jombey if its attack is equal to its defense, starting at level 24.
